残膜对土壤和作物的潜在风险研究进展

摘要:
残膜作为一种持续性农业污染物,对农业生态系统的危害作用备受国内外学者关注,关于残膜对土壤性质和作物生长发育的不利影响已被很多研究证实。综述了残膜分布状况和残膜对土壤理化性质和生物性质、作物生理指标等方面的影响,具体概述了中国残膜的分布特征,残膜对土壤体积质量、孔隙度、土壤透气性、土壤重金属、酞酸酯类化合物质量分数、土壤酶活性和作物生长发育等方面的影响。为减弱残膜对土壤性质和作物的不利影响,今后应在以下几方面进行深入研究:不同类型作物的最佳揭膜期和地膜厚度;研发和推广新型残膜回收机械;残膜对农业生态系统的长期效应;残膜对不同土壤和区域的影响规律。

Potential Risks of Plastic Film Residuals on Soils and Crops: A Review

Abstract:
The residuals of plastic films used in producing foods could become a pollutant and their potential adverse impact on agroecological systems has attracted increased attention. Some studies have shown that these residuals have a detrimental effect on soil quality and crop yields. We review in this paper the distribution of plastic-film residuals in China, as well as their impact on soil quality, soil porosity, gaseous permeability of soil, heavy metals, content of phthalate esters, enzymatic activity and crop growth. To reduce the detrimental impact of plastic-film residualson soil quality and crop development, future research should focus on ①rational film-covering time and film thickness for different crops; ②developing and implementing improved film-removing technologies;③improving our understanding of the long-term effect of plastic-film residuals on agroecological systems; ④understanding the impact ofthe residuals on different soil types and textures across China.
